According to
Reuters, the Sakhalin 2 LNG plant in Russia has sold an LNG cargo to Mitsui for loading on 16 March.
Three industry sources with knowledge of the matter claim the facility sold the cargo at approximately US$2.70/million Btu – US$2.80/million Btu.
The facility has a capacity of more than 10 million tpy. It has two trains, which were launched in 2009.
